What you will do

Perform the installation of fire protection piping, valves and accessories for commercial and industrial application. Must be able to work alternative shifts or weekends to meet customer and/or job requirements. Must perform all duties in a safe and professional manner.

 

How you will do it


  • Installation experience on all types of automatic fire protection systems

  • Maintain proper documentation for work performed

  • Must adhere to company safety policies and procedures

  • Follow verbal and written instructions

  • Carry/move equipment and tools weighing up to 75 lbs

  • Perform work in unusual and sometimes difficult positions; such as climbing ladders, scaffolding, and high lift equipment

  • Responsible for providing quality workmanship

  • Responsible for the supervision of helper and apprentice level fitters

  • Responsible for interpreting drawings and maintaining red line sets daily

  • Maintain a clean and safe work area

  • Other duties as assigned

What we look for 

 

Required


  • High School Diploma or equivalent

  • 2+ years of previous experience with fire sprinkler installation/service

  • Experienced in reading, interpreting and identifying field conflicts on

  • Sprinkler installation drawings

  • Must be able to act as lead foreman

  • Required to attend weekly foreman meetings

  • Displays professionalism in communication with customers

  • Prefer NICET level II or higher

  • Understand NFPA 13 installation requirements

  • Valid Driver’s License with good driving record

  • Carry/move equipment and tools weighing up to 70lbs and perform work in unusual and sometimes difficult positions; such as climbing ladders, scaffolding, and high lift equipment

  • Must be able to work alternative shifts or weekends, on-call rotation and overnight traveling to meet customer and/or job requirements

  • Must have the physical agility to work in challenging environments and spaces, this includes, ducts, crawl spaces, basements, attics, on ladders, scaffolding, all while carrying tools and equipment
